Story summary
- A freight train derailed in Mansfield, Connecticut on Thursday around 9 a.m., sending four propane cars into the water and two food-grade grease cars onto the banks.
- The grease cars leaked about 2,000 gallons of animal fat.
- There were no injuries reported.
- A shelter-in-place order remains within a half-mile of the incident.
- Recovery may take days due to the remote location and harsh conditions.
